[Partially fixed] Thumbnail shadow bug

Posted: Sat Jun 25, 2005 12:59 pm
by Dreamer
Only if you have non white background colour for window in Windows Display properties...

Image

Solution #1 (easier):

Override Windows background colour setting - always use white colour as background - only if shadow is used in xnview.

Solution #2 (maybe even impossible):

Make white colour under shadow transparent.
